domain in the Adoption functional area.You can create adoption items to plan short-term or long-term feature adoption. Create adoption items from content on the
Adoption Planning
dashboard to track and represent deployment information as it relates to your business.- Access theCreate Adoption Itemtask.
- As you complete the task, consider:FieldConsiderationsTypeSelect a type to categorize the adoption item.Example: SelectNew Featureto represent a What's New item you want to implement.Priority EvaluationPrioritize your adoption items with labels that reflect their importance. You can also create customPrioritylabels to meet the needs of your organization.StatusThe status you set on an adoption item determines where it displays.Example: SelectIn Backlogto move an item to the backlog and manage it on theMaintain Adoption Backlogtask.InactiveSelect theInactivecheck box to deactivate an item so that it doesn't display on the backlog.Custom Dates and ReleasesUse theCustom Date 1andCustom Date 2fields to create a unique time frame for deployment. Connect your deployment to a release unique to your business by:
- Accessing theMaintain Adoption Customer Releasestask.
- Using theCustomer Releasefield in theRoadmapsection of the task.
What's New ReferenceUse this prompt to create links between your adoption item and release notes published in theWhat's New in Workdayreport. - (Optional) Access theWhat's New Item Actionstask to create a large quantity of adoption items for features documented in theWhat's New in Workdayreport.
